Montenegro’s Dedication to Youth Involvement: A New Chapter of Cooperation
In a meaningful move towards fostering intergenerational dialog and enhancing youth participation in policymaking, Montenegrin legislators have officially ratified a Declaration aimed at strengthening collaboration with the younger demographic. This initiative, supported by the Institution for Security and Co-operation in Europe (OSCE), aspires to elevate youth engagement in democratic processes, ensuring their viewpoints are effectively incorporated into legislative discussions. Montenegro’s Youth Engagement Initiative: A Legislative Breakthrough
The recent endorsement of this Declaration marks an essential advancement in promoting collaboration between Montenegrin lawmakers and young citizens. With OSCE backing, this initiative aims to establish an ongoing dialogue framework connecting Members of Parliament (MPs) with youth across Montenegro. The agreement underscores an increasing recognition of youth involvement as vital within democratic systems, laying the foundation for future initiatives that empower young individuals to actively voice their opinions while influencing policies that affect their lives.
The Declaration delineates several key objectives designed to strengthen ties between lawmakers and young people:
- Continuous Consultations: Creating platforms for regular discussions involving MPs alongside representatives from youth organizations.
- Policy Involvement: Establishing pathways through which young individuals can contribute meaningfully during policy formulation stages.
- Civic Education Initiatives: Launching programs aimed at educating youths about democratic principles and civic duties.
- Nongovernmental Collaborations: Partnering with local and international NGOs focused on enhancing opportunities for youth engagement.
